Meritorious student is broke for higher studies

Nepalgunj, July 18:

A student who passed the SLC exam this year securing distinction marks is worried about raising funds for higher studies.

Bhim Bahadur Khadka, 16, who passed the SLC exam from the Khajura-based Gyanodaya Higher Secondary School of Bageshwori VDC with 80 per cent marks lacks fund for his higher studies.

“As we have no property, I am finding it difficult to manage funds. My father is in India and my mother is a daily wager “ Bhim Bahadur said.

“I want to bcome an engineer after joining the science faculty, however, my dream is very difficult to materialise due to the lack of fund,” Bhim said, adding he wished someone provided him a scholarship for studies .

Assistant headmaster of Gyanodaya School Rishiram Sapkota said that Bhim Bahadur was disciplined and studious since childhood.

“As the economic condition is very poor, the school provided scholarship up to SLC to Bhim Bahadur,” Sapkota added.

Three brothers and one sister of Bhim Bahadur have already married and are living separately.
